On Sun, 2008-10-05 at 07:40 -0700, ydjango wrote:
> I have more than one input submit button and want to know which one
> was clicked.
> Request.POST does not have that information for some reason.

So you mean you have the same problem you had when you first posted this
message less than one day earlier? Please wait a little while for people
who might have the time to answer your question. Remember that everybody
posting on this list is doing so as a volunteer.

> 
> Using django 1.0 svn
> 
> I would appreciate if you can point me to right resource.
> This is should be something very simple that I am missing.
> 
> 
> On Oct 4, 11:44 am, ydjango <[EMAIL PROTECTED]> wrote:
> > I do not see the name of submit button in request.POST. it has all
> > other form fields
> >
> >  if request.POST.has_key('save'):
> >      does not work too

That's exactly how it should be done. There must be something special or
slightly wrong about the way you've constructed your form or your view.
Perhaps you could construct a very small example (a form with only one
buttone and the corresponding view function) that doesn't work and paste
it in full -- it should only be a dozen lines or so total. Then we might
be able to see what you're doing wrong.

Based on the information you have provided so far, this should work.

Have you looked at what keys *are* being submitted in request.POST?
Maybe that will provide a clue.

Regards,
Malcolm



--~--~---------~--~----~------------~-------~--~----~
You received this message because you are subscribed to the Google Groups 
"Django users" group.
To post to this group, send email to django-users@googlegroups.com
To unsubscribe from this group, send email to [EMAIL PROTECTED]
For more options, visit this group at 
http://groups.google.com/group/django-users?hl=en
-~----------~----~----~----~------~----~------~--~---

Reply via email to